About James C. Edwards
James C. Edwards is a scholar working on Mechanical Engineering, Control and Systems Engineering, Philosophy, Physiology and Human-Computer Interaction, having authored 16 papers that have together received 406 indexed citations. Recurring topics across this work include Teleoperation and Haptic Systems (5 papers), Robot Manipulation and Learning (4 papers), Nitric Oxide and Endothelin Effects (3 papers), Virtual Reality Applications and Impacts (3 papers), Wittgensteinian philosophy and applications (2 papers), Embodied and Extended Cognition (2 papers), Epistemology, Ethics, and Metaphysics (1 paper) and Paranormal Experiences and Beliefs (1 paper). The work is most often cited by research in Biochemistry (66 citations), Physiology (183 citations), Philosophy (62 citations), Biophysics (21 citations) and Endocrine and Autonomic Systems (18 citations). James C. Edwards has collaborated with scholars based in United States, Brazil and Australia. Frequent co-authors include Louis J. Ignarro, Darlene Y. Gruetter, Barbara K. Barry, Carl A. Gruetter, Eliot H. Ohlstein, William H. Baricos, Greg R. Luecke, Ludwig Wittgenstein, G. H. von Wright and Young Ho Chai. Their work appears in journals such as Biochemical and Biophysical Research Communications, Pacific philosophical quarterly, Biochemical Pharmacology, FEBS Letters and Journal of Consciousness Studies.
